To maximize the flavor and smell of your coffee, you should purchase the freshest coffee beans you can. It is best to buy small quantities and store them in an airtight container like a Ziploc or coffee jar. The beans should be kept in a dark, cool place to avoid the loss of heat and light exposure. If you leave beans exposed to air, they could quickly oxidize and lose flavor and aroma.
It is recommended to use medium roast beans using a bean-to-cup machine. This is because beans with a darker roast tend to be more oily, which can lead to the burrs of a machine becoming clogged and stopping it from extracting the maximum amount of flavor. Medium roast beans that are matte in appearance (meaning they've not been roasted nearer to or over the second crack) can help avoid this.
Another important factor to consider when selecting a coffee bean is the size of the grind. A more fine grind allows water to pass more easily through the ground, which will improve extraction. A coarser grind may result in the opposite effect and make it harder for the water to get to the beans. This could result in the coffee being diluted and isn't fully extracted. It is a good idea, therefore, to experiment with different sizes of grinders and choose the one that best suits your needs.
